Why are a cat's whiskers black and white?

Why are a cat's whiskers black and white? - briefly

The coloration of a cat's whiskers is primarily determined by genetics. The genes responsible for coat color also influence the color of the whiskers, which is why they often match or complement the cat's fur.

Why are a cat's whiskers black and white? - in detail

The coloration of a cat's whiskers, often observed as black and white, is a result of several biological and genetic factors. Whiskers, also known as vibrissae, are specialized hairs that serve crucial sensory functions for cats. They are deeply embedded in the cat's facial muscles and are connected to the nervous system, allowing them to detect even the slightest changes in their environment.

The pigmentation of whiskers is influenced by the same genes that determine the color of a cat's fur. Melanin, the pigment responsible for color in skin and hair, comes in two primary forms: eumelanin, which produces black or brown colors, and pheomelanin, which produces red or yellow colors. The distribution and concentration of these pigments determine the final color of the whiskers. In many cats, the whiskers exhibit a bicolor pattern due to the presence of both eumelanin and pheomelanin, resulting in a mix of black and white hues.

The black color in whiskers is typically due to the presence of eumelanin, which provides a dark pigment. The white color, on the other hand, is the result of a lack of pigmentation, often due to genetic factors that inhibit the production of melanin. This genetic variation can lead to a wide range of whisker colors and patterns, including solid black, solid white, and various combinations of the two.

Additionally, the environment and health of the cat can also affect the appearance of the whiskers. Nutritional deficiencies, stress, and certain medical conditions can alter the pigmentation and overall health of the whiskers. For instance, a diet lacking in essential nutrients may result in weaker or discolored whiskers.

In summary, the black and white coloration of a cat's whiskers is a product of genetic inheritance, specifically the distribution and type of melanin produced. The sensory function of whiskers is not affected by their color, but their appearance can provide insights into the cat's overall health and genetic makeup.
